If you like tequila, you owe it to yourself to enjoy a true 100% agave tequila, not a mixto (only 51% agave tequila like Jose) tequila such as Patron, Corazon, Cabo Wabo, Don Eduardo, and Casa Noble to name a few. If you like the gold version of Jose, you would probably love the Reposado (aged between 3 months and 1 year) versions of any of those 100% agave...

  15. I have tried a few different protein type bars but the one that I always come back to is the Honeybar Organic Trail Mix bar. They are 200 calories, have 13g of fat (mostly good fats), 1.5g of Sat. fat, 17g of carbs, 2g of fiber, 12g of sugar, 7 grams of protein (why I like them), and they taste good too!
